LG inaugurates 3 projects of Srinagar Smart City
5/12/2023 10:49:26 PM

Early Times Report

Srinagar, May 12: Lieutenant Governor Shri Manoj Sinha inaugurated three Srinagar Smart City Projects and 25 Urban Local bodies (ULB) projects, today.
Of the three Smart City Projects, Polo View has been transformed into Pedestrian-Oriented Shopping Street, Abi Guzar Shiv temple has been renovated and dedicated to the people and Smart Advanced Traffic Management vehicles have been included in the fleet for Srinagar Smart City.
Of the Urban Local bodies (ULB) projects dedicated to the public today, 16 are development projects in 11 ULBs and 9 Solid Waste Management facilities in 10 ULBs.
On the occasion, the Lt Governor said, these projects will significantly boost urban infrastructure and give an impetus to ease of living.
“Polo View in the heart of Srinagar has been transformed into pedestrian-oriented high street that will attract more footfall, increase in retail sale, improve experience of visitors and it will make the area more liveable," said the Lt Governor.
Sharing the efforts to create facilities at par with other big cities of the country, the Lt Governor said, the Polo View market is just the beginning. In coming days, Srinagar Smart City is developing similar markets in areas like Residency road, Lal Chowk, and the old city, he added.

At the Polo View, the Lt Governor interacted with the shop-keepers and presented a token of appreciation to the Traders association for their cooperation.
Bicycle sharing facilities for different locations in the city was also inaugurated on the occasion by the Lt Governor.
Sh H Rajesh Prasad, Principal Secretary Housing & Urban Development Department gave a detailed overview of the projects inaugurated today.
Ms Mathora Masoom, Director Urban Local Bodies Kashmir informed about the ongoing projects for the development of urban areas of the region.
Sh Junaid Azim Mattu, Mayor SMC; Sh Vijay Kumar, ADGP Kashmir; Sh Vijay Kumar Bidhuri, Divisional Commissioner Kashmir; Sh Athar Amir Khan, Commissioner SMC and CEO Srinagar Smart City; ULB members, senior officials and prominent citizens were present.
